Main duties of the job
The Governance Administration Assistant is a key role in
supporting the Director of Governance in areas of clinical governance and
quality assurance of the Haxby Group services delivered in Hull, Scarborough
and York. The postholder will be responsible for a range of administration
tasks and collation of reports.
The post holder will support the Director and Associate
Director of Governance in co-ordinating all key activity including annual
assurance plans and quality improvement plans. This role will include liaising
with other Directors and managers to gather information and meet timelines.

Job description
Job responsibilities
Job responsibilities:
The post holder will support the delivery of the governance and quality and assurance annual work plan by:
- Monitor incoming alerts and circulate to managers following flow charts and standard operating procedures.
- Completing spreadsheets with information on a monthly and quarterly frequency
- Receiving and filing audit reports and drafting summary reports
- Working to an annual planner to send reminders and receive documents to present at meetings.
- Monitor and report frequency of multi-disciplinary meeting across each of the hubs in each city.
- Maintain a register of policies and standard operating procedures, highlighting to managers those due for renewal.
- Support the lead for patient experience team to collate monthly and quarterly reports of significant events and complaints.
- Support the Lead Clinician for Quality, Standards & Compliance in developing shared learning briefings.
- Support Head of Nursing in collecting infection prevention and control audits.
Strategy and leadership responsibilities:
- Work with the Governance team to deliver the Haxby strategy and the Governance work plan.
- Contribute to compliance with statutory and contractual standards including the Care Quality Commission regulations.
